Capacity note for the Bramblewick export retry queue. Failed exports are requeued with exponential backoff, and the queue depth is our main capacity signal: sustained depth above the high-water mark means downstream Pellis storage is saturated, not that we need more workers. As the new contractor, please don't raise worker counts without checking storage latency first — it usually makes things worse. Retry timing, backoff caps, and the high-water threshold are all driven by the constants shown below.

limits module of yagef-bajog:
TIERS = {
    "druael": 370,
    "tamix": 286,
    "pelius": 541,
    "pelael": 78,
    "pelox": 47,
    "ralath": 533,
    "drumir": 801,
}

Briefing — Leadership Review, Marrow & Finch

For heads of department. The pilot with the Ostlerby retail chain completed its fourth week. Adoption of our Quillstone checkout module is at 72% across the five trial stores, above target. Two integration issues were resolved; one remains open with the chain's IT group. Expansion terms are under negotiation. The commercial direction is summarised in the confidential note below.

confidential, kagup-bafog: Fraaxax Group is in early talks to buy Soroxox Group for about $343.8 million. The Olidor launch date is June 14, and nothing goes to the press before then. Legal wants the Aldmirek Logistics term sheet signed before July 23.

Hey, welcome aboard! If the Harvestline gateway CI starts failing on the telemetry-replay stage, it's almost always the flaky CAN-bus fixture, not your code. Re-run once before digging in. If it fails twice, grab the gateway simulator logs from the pipeline artifacts and check whether the Plowmark firmware stub booted. When you file the issue, include the token below.

pipeline stamp: htk9_ce63042d9